Yards and Yards of Savings : Sharp shoppers can find deep discounts on fine fabrics and custom-made drapes at Stern’s.

There is one category of merchandise that I buy whether I need it or not--and that is fabric--gorgeous fabric at low prices. Somewhere down the line there will be a use for it, either for a chair, curtains, a wall hanging or a gift.

A new source for a fabric foray, Stern’s, has arrived in the San Fernando Valley after 40 years in downtown Los Angeles. Its reputation as a source for custom-made draperies has been known by sharp shoppers for years, but only since September has the Valley textile junkie been able to pore through the company’s extensive selection of home decorating fabrics.

The first visit can be overwhelming. Hundreds of bolts of fabric confront the shopper at the front door of this former bank building. But owner Kevin Stern knows exactly where everything is and can lead you to the proper section. Tapestries from Italy that retail at many of the designer showrooms for $40 sell here for $18. Stern says they made such an excellent buy in crewel fabric that they can offer it at $20 a yard instead of the usual $50 to $60. In addition, some beautiful damasks at $22 a yard represent a sizable saving from the regular retail of $65 to $70.

Florals from Mill Creek and Covington mills, marked from $5 to $8.50, reflect prices 50% and more off the original price. A cotton floral from 5th Avenue Designs that I purchased several years ago from a discounter and paid $18 a yard for was marked to move at $5. What a find!

In the drapery department--much of which is located in the vault--there are some surprises, too. Instead of the usual four or five basic colors in antique satins, we found at least 25 shades ranging in price from $3 to $5 a yard. At many sources these would run from $10 to $12. Some ready-mades are available and range in price from $20 to $48.

When we contacted several of Stern’s recent drapery customers, their reports on the company’s service, prices and workmanship were uniformly positive. One shopper, who went to the store with a sketch of the window treatment she wanted was stunned when Stern’s quoted her $475; she had received a quote from a major Los Angeles discount chain for $1,700.

Stern’s is a family business, their overhead is low because they own their building, and they work with a minimum of personnel.
